What is PACE®?
Program of All-inclusive Care for the Elderly (PACE) is a Medicare and Medicaid funded option that gives community-based care and services to people 55 or older, helping to prevent nursing home placement. PACE provides coverage for prescription drugs, doctor care, transportation, home care, checkups, hospital visits, and nursing home stays when necessary. Private pay is also available.
Team Approach to Care
Care Resources embraces your physical, mental, and social health in a “one-stop shopping” model with you at the center. Our healthcare team includes physicians, nurses, social workers, dieticians, therapists (physical, occupational, and recreational), home care coordinators, and other staff.
